5) you did 170 joules of work lifting a 140 n backpack. how high did you lift the backpack?
6) in problem 5 how much did the backpack weigh in pounds (hint there are 4.45 newtons in one pound)

Ответ:
d = 1.21 meters
The mass of the backpack is 31.48 pound.
Explanation:
(5) Work done in lifting a backpack, W = 170 J
The force acting on the backpack, F = 140 N
The work done by an object is given by :
d is the height at which the backpack is lifted
d = 1.21 meters
So, the backpack is lifted to a height of 1.21 meters.
(6) If m is the mass of the backpack. It can be calculated as :
W = mg
m = 14.28 kg
Since, 1 kg = 2.204 pound
14.28 kg = 31.48 pound
So, the mass of the backpack is 31.48 pound. Hence, this is the required solution.
